What happens while it is decided

This application is with Yorkshire Dales National Park for determination, against a statutory target of eight weeks. Over the last year Yorkshire Dales National Park decided advertisement consent applications in a median of 77 days. More in our guide to how long planning decisions take.

About advertisement consent applications

Advertisement consent is judged on two things only: amenity and public safety, not competition or other planning considerations. More in our guide to planning application types.
